    Damage

    Keys can be damaged due to wear and tear. This is caused by the combination of repeated use, lack of maintenance, and improper handling and storage.

    The damage can affect the lock and/or ignition. It could be a sign of a more serious problem.

    It is not uncommon for keys to your car to stop working, even if you're using it properly and the locks on your vehicle are working properly. It is important to diagnose the problem and seek assistance from a professional.

    replacement keys for cars that your traditional car keys do not work is if the grooves of the key are worn down and aren't aligned with the lock or the ignition mechanism. If this is the case, your key can be repaired by an expert locksmith.

    It is not advisable to insert a broken car key into your vehicle's ignition as it can damage the chip. This is particularly the case for transponder keys.

    In addition, the transponder chip is sensitive to water, and dropping the key on a damp surface or submerging it into water can short out the chips inside and cause issues.

    Avoiding dropping your keys on a muddy or wet surface is the best way to avoid this. Keep your keys in your trunk.

    It is recommended to have the keys to your vehicle examined by a certified technician when you spot any signs of wear and tear. This will provide you with an idea of the state of your keys, and allow you to make an informed decision regarding replacing them.





    A locksmith near you can make a new car key with your vehicle's unique code. They can program the key to work with the current system and make sure it works correctly.

    Furthermore, certain car workshops and service providers offer the repair of keys that could be a good solution to restore your damaged car keys back on the road. This could help you save money.

    Lost Keys

    It can be incredibly frustrating to lose your keys. It can also be costly. It's why it's essential to be prepared with the situation before it occurs.

    In certain instances it is recommended to contact a locksmith dealership and ask them to make a new key for you. These experts can quickly get you back on your way without any hassles.

    One thing to remember is that there are numerous types of car keys. Each type of key requires a unique procedure for replacement.

    For instance, you could need to provide the VIN of your vehicle in order to get a new key. The process might take longer if you have an unusual or new vehicle. You might have to visit a dealer to obtain the key.

    Some car models have a tracker to assist you in finding your key that you have lost. If this is the case, still contact a locksmith or dealership because they will have cut the new key to match the existing key's programming.
